Dhurandhar 2 sets new benchmark with historic Day 1 box office collection
News Mania Desk /Piyal Chatterjee/ 20th March 2026

The much-anticipated Bollywood sequel Dhurandhar 2: The Revenge, starring Ranveer Singh and directed by Aditya Dhar, has rewritten box office history with a record-breaking opening day collection worldwide.
According to early estimates, the film grossed approximately ₹240 crore globally on its first day, making it the biggest opening ever for a Hindi film. The film’s domestic performance was equally impressive, earning around ₹145 crore net in India—an unprecedented figure in Bollywood history.
With this massive debut, Dhurandhar 2 has surpassed the opening day collections of several blockbuster films, including Jawan, Pathaan, Animal, and Baahubali 2: The Conclusion. It now stands among the biggest openers in Indian cinema, trailing only Pushpa 2: The Rule in overall records.
Trade analysts attribute the film’s phenomenal start to strong advance bookings, extensive paid previews, and high audience anticipation. The film’s large-scale action narrative and pan-India appeal have also contributed significantly to its widespread success across domestic and international markets.
Notably, Dhurandhar 2 has become the first Bollywood film to cross the ₹200 crore mark globally on its opening day, setting a new benchmark for future releases. With such an extraordinary start, industry experts predict a dominant box office run in the coming days, positioning the film as one of the biggest hits of the year.
